Buying Guide: How to Choose a Wall Mounted Heating And Cooling Unit
- Room size and BTU: Match unit cooling and heating capacity to the room square footage to avoid over- or under-conditioning.
- Installation requirements: Consider whether you prefer a ductless system, a fully wall-mounted unit, or a unit that can be moved or installed without major renovations.
- Energy efficiency: Look for inverter or smart operation features that adjust compressor speed for lower energy consumption and steadier temperatures.
- Noise level: For bedrooms or study areas, prioritize models with quiet operation or sleep modes to minimize disturbance.
- Heat source and climate: In very cold climates, ensure the unit provides meaningful supplemental heating or robust cooling/heating for year-round use.
- Maintenance and filters: Check for accessible filters and straightforward maintenance requirements to preserve performance over time.
- Additional features: Dehumidification, remote control, smart timers, and sleep modes can improve comfort and convenience.
Frequently Asked Questions
- What is a wall-mounted mini split system best used for?
Best used in spaces where ductwork is impractical or unavailable, offering year-round cooling and heating with a compact, wall-mounted indoor unit and an outdoor condenser.
- Do these units require professional installation?
Some models require professional installation for proper mounting and electrical connections, while others are designed for simpler wall mounting and plug-in operation.
- Can wall-mounted units cool and heat large rooms?
Yes, but verify BTU ratings for the room size. Larger rooms may need higher-capacity models or multiple units for even distribution.
- Are supplemental heat units energy-efficient?
Many include inverter technology or smart modes that reduce energy use, but overall efficiency depends on climate and room insulation.
- What maintenance do these units require?
Regular filter cleaning or replacement, detector checks for airflow, and occasional professional service for refrigerant or electrical components when needed.
- Is it better to choose a 2-in-1 unit or separate cooling and heating devices?
2-in-1 units save space and simplify setup, but dedicated cooling and heating devices may offer higher efficiency or capacity in larger spaces.
